Looks like someone painted them with some cheap paint already ? (Used car lot ?). I would just take 'em off and remove all that crap paint and then prime 'em and repaint with some Rustoleum Performance Matte Black paint (Home Depot). I did that on one of my other trucks and it's held up really well and still looks good. They are just matte black from the factory. Just takes a little time to do it right.
